Hi,

I have RF5 also and this is a very good speaker!! the RC3 II will match the RF5 in timbre butt sounds a little brighter in the hights.

It is a vey good center for the money.

Last week I had the RC3 II in my setup and I found it sounds to direct in the high frequenties so I orderd a RC 7 for the center job.

The RC 7 is a very diffrent speaker in comperison with the RC3 II. The RF 5 will match the RC3 butt the RC 7 will be nicer!!!!

So if I was you save your money now for the RC 7.
